KARACHI: The local government fired Agha Sohail, who was in charge of the Sindh Textbook Board.
Agha Sohail removed as Sindh Textbook Chairman
A formal notice from the Sindh government announced the removal of Agha Sohail, the head of the Textbook Board. The notice stated that Agha Sohail lost his job because he broke the rules.
The message says there are claims of wrongdoing in making school books about the leader.

The local government picked Akhtar Bugti as the head of the Sindh Textbook Board.
Remember, Agha Sohail, the Sindh Textbook Board leader, was taken away from the job because of accusations of corruption.
